Police Arrest Man In U-District Serial Burglaries

Posted: 10:02 am PDT October 9, 2009

A man was arrested in a series of burglaries at University District fraternities on Greek row Friday.

Police said the latest burglary occurred at a fraternity house in the 4600 block of 21st Avenue Northeast at about 4:45 a.m.

An officer noticed a man in the area who matched the description of the burglar from previous incidents, police said.

Police said the man had 12 iPods in his possession at the time of arrest.

He was booked into the King County Jail on charges of investigation of burglary.
